Application

Flexible Manufacturing Systems in the sheet processing industry require an automated reliable monitoring in order to protect stamping presses and other sheet processing equipment against damage caused by multiple sheet feeding. 

The Double Sheet Control System R1000 L20 was specifically developed for this technical environment. Particular attention was given to maintenance free operation and self monitoring features of the measuring system. 

New functions have been added to ensure less failure and down time during operation. Thus the investment is recovered within a few months of operation with full process reliability.

Two pairs of  sensors can be connected to the three-channel processing unit. The measurement is simultaneously possible for all three channels. The device also supports the connection of the sensor type + LAAS. These sensors feature a laser beam monitoring for an increased process reliability. 

 

Features & Technical Data

  • Suitable for magnetic feed systems without speed limitation
  • Up to three sensor pairs on one device (3-channel version)
  • Absolute measuring method
  • Digital display of material thickness and operating parameters
  • Monitoring of oversize and undersize limits
  • Laser function and sensor distance monitoring
  • Integrated fieldbus interface with process and parameter interface
Function principle: Laser triangulation, laser class 2, EN 60825-1
Material and thickness: All materials, 0.3 - 15 mm, with fixed sensor distance (Ax = 40 mm)
Measuring method: Dual head non-contacting Double Sheet Detection
Programs: 255 measuring programs, adjustable
Particularities: All materials, also for non-metals and composites, non-transparent materials
